如何通过composer安装与PHP5.2兼容的PHPUnit?

如何通过composer安装与PHP5.2兼容的PHPUnit?,php,phpunit,backwards-compatibility,Php,Phpunit,Backwards Compatibility,这是为那些坚持PHP5.2的人准备的,他们不需要梨,只需要作曲家 欢迎另一个更好的解决方案 但更合适的解决方案是在PackageGist上添加这些版本。即使有一些标签,比如x.y.z-backwards。我只是为它祈祷。去安装这个软件包 添加到您的作曲家: "require-dev": { "phpunit/phpunit-php52": "dev-3.6.12-php52", "phpunit/phpunit-mock-objects-php52": "dev-1.1.0-ph

这是为那些坚持PHP5.2的人准备的,他们不需要梨,只需要作曲家

欢迎另一个更好的解决方案

但更合适的解决方案是在PackageGist上添加这些版本。即使有一些标签,比如x.y.z-backwards。我只是为它祈祷。

去安装这个软件包

添加到您的作曲家:

"require-dev": {
    "phpunit/phpunit-php52": "dev-3.6.12-php52",
    "phpunit/phpunit-mock-objects-php52": "dev-1.1.0-php52"
},
"repositories": [
    {
        "type": "git",
        "url": "https://github.com/garex/phpunit"
    },
    {
        "type": "git",
        "url": "https://github.com/garex/phpunit-mock-objects"
    }
]

github repos的默认分支是3.6.12-php52和1.1.0-php52,因此可以快速安装它们。

如果您已经有了一个副本,并且正在寻找如何通过composer使安装快速简便,那么您可以设置自己的包存储库来存储它,并将composer指向它。@STLMikey安装需要更多步骤。我想要一些简单明了的东西——只需在composer.json中添加一些东西并运行update。也可以为所有其他人提供。